ICSA-20-212-04: Mitsubishi electric c controller interface module utility vulnerability
Affected Software
47 affected components
Mitsubishi Electric C Controller Interface Module Utility, Versions 2.00 and prior
Mitsubishi Electric CC-Link IE Control Network Data Collector, Version 1.00A
Mitsubishi Electric CC-Link IE Field Network Data Collector, Version 1.00A
Mitsubishi Electric CC-Link IE TSN Data Collector, Version 1.00A
Mitsubishi Electric CPU Module Logging Configuration Tool, Versions 1.100E and prior
Mitsubishi Electric CW Configurator, Versions 1.010L and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Data Transfer, Versions 3.42U and prior
Mitsubishi Electric EZSocket, version 5.1 and prior
Mitsubishi Electric FR Configurator SW3, All versions
Mitsubishi Electric FR Configurator2: Versions 1.26C and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GT Designer2 Classic, all versions
Mitsubishi Electric GT Designer3 Version1 (GOT1000), Versions 1.241B and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GT Designer3 Version1 (GOT2000), Versions 1.241B and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GT SoftGOT1000 Version3, Versions 3.200J and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GT SoftGOT2000 Version1, Versions 1.241B and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GX Developer, Versions 8.504A and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GX LogViewer, Versions 1.100E and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GX Works2, Versions 1.601B and prior
Mitsubishi Electric GX Works3, Versions 1.063R and prior
Mitsubishi Electric M_CommDTM-IO-Link, Versions 1.03D and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MELFA-Works: Version 4.4 and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MELSEC WinCPU Setting Utility, All versions
Mitsubishi Electric MELSOFT Complete Clean Up Tool, Versions 1.06G and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MELSOFT EM Software Development Kit, Versions 1.015R and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MELSOFT iQ AppPortal, 1.17T and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MELSOFT Navigator, Versions 2.74C and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MI Configurator, Version 1.004E and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Motion Control Setting, Versions 1.005F and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Motorizer, Versions 1.005F and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MR Configurator2, Version 1.125F and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MT Works2, Version 1.167Z and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MTConnect Data Collector, Version 1.1.4.0 and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MX Component, Version 4.20W and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MX MESInterface, Versions 1.21X and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MX MESInterface-R, Versions 1.12N and prior
Mitsubishi Electric MX Sheet, Version 2.15R and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Network Interface Board CC IE Control Utility, Versions 1.29F and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Network Interface Board CC IE Field Utility, Versions 1.16S and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Network Interface Board CC-Link Ver.2 Utility, Versions 1.23Z and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Network Interface Board MNETH Utility, Versions 34L and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Position Board Utility 2<=3.20
Mitsubishi Electric PX Developer, version 1.53F and prior
Mitsubishi Electric RT ToolBox2: Version 3.73B and prior
Mitsubishi Electric RT ToolBox3: Version 1.82L and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Setting/Monitoring tools for the C Controller module (SW3PVC-CCPU), Version 3.13P and prior
Mitsubishi Electric Setting/Monitoring tools for the C Controller module (SW4PVC-CCPU), Version 4.12N and prior
Mitsubishi Electric SLMP Data Collector, Version 1.04E and prior
